Selling Online: Etsy's platform vs. Shopify's control

Choosing the right platform Etsy vs Shopify to sell your goods online can be a tough decision. Two popular options are Etsy, known for its vibrant community of crafters and vintage sellers, and Shopify, which offers unparalleled customization over your store's look.

Etsy provides a built-in audience for handmade and unique items. Its supportive atmosphere can be a great resource for new sellers, but it also comes with certain boundaries.

Shopify, on the other hand, allows you to create a truly personalized store that reflects your brand. You have full authority over your platform's design, functionality, and pricing structure.

Ultimately, the best platform for you depends on your specific needs and aspirations. Consider factors like your offering, target market, and budget when making your decision.
